LIMITS(4-SysV)      RISC/os Reference Manual       LIMITS(4-SysV)



NAME
     limits - header files for implementation-specific constants

SYNOPSIS
     #include < limits.h>
     #include < float.h>
     #include < sys/limits.h>

DESCRIPTION
     The header file < limits.h> specifies the sizes of intergral
     types as required by the proposed ANSI C standard.  The
     header file < float.h> specifies the characteristics of
     floating types as required by the proposed ANSI C standard.
     The constants that refer to long doubles that should appear
     in < float.h> are not specified because MIPS does not imple-
     ment long doubles.  The header file < sys/limits.h> is a
     list of magnitude limitations imposed by a specific imple-
     mentation of the operating system.  All values in the files
     are specified in decimal.  The file < limits.h> contains:

          #define CHAR_BIT       8              /* # of bits in a ``char'' */
          #define SCHAR_MIN      (-128)         /* min integer value of a ``signed char'' */
          #define SCHAR_MAX      (+127)         /* max integer value of a ``signed char'' */
          #define UCHAR_MAX      255            /* max integer value of an ``unsigned char'' */
          #define CHAR_MIN       0              /* min integer value of a ``char'' */
          #define CHAR_MAX       255            /* max integer value of a ``char'' */
          #define SHRT_MIN       (-32768)       /* min decimal value of a ``short'' */
          #define SHRT_MAX       (+32767)       /* max decimal value of a ``short'' */
          #define USHRT_MAX      65535          /* max decimal value of an ``unsigned short'' */
          #define INT_MIN (-2147483648)         /* min decimal value of an ``int'' */
          #define INT_MAX (+2147483647)         /* max decimal value of a ``int'' */
          #define UINT_MAX       4294967295     /* max decimal value of an ``unsigned int'' */
          #define LONG_MIN       (-2147483648)  /* min decimal value of a ``long'' */
          #define LONG_MAX       (+2147483647)  /* max decimal value of a ``long'' */
          #define ULONG_MAX      4294967295     /* max decimal value of an ``unsigned long'' */

          #define USI_MAX 4294967295            /* max decimal value of an ``unsigned'' */
          #define WORD_BIT       32             /* # of bits in a ``word'' or ``int'' */

     The file < float.h> contains:

          #define FLT_RADIX           2       /* radix of exponent representation */
          #define FLT_ROUNDS          1       /* addition rounds (>0 implemention-defined) */
          /* number of base-FLT_RADIX digits in the floating point mantissa */
          #define FLT_MANT_DIG        24
          #define DBL_MANT_DIG        53
          /* minimum positive floating-point number x such that 1.0 + x ≠ 1.0 */
          #define FLT_EPSILON         1.19209290e-07
          #define DBL_EPSILON         2.2204460492503131e-16
          /* number of decimal digits of precision */
          #define FLT_DIG 6
          #define DBL_DIG 15

          /* minimum negitive integer such that FLT_RADIX raised to that power minus 1
          is a normalized floating point number */
          #define FLT_MIN_EXP         -125
          #define DBL_MIN_EXP         -1021
          /* minimum normalized positive floating-point number */
          #define FLT_MIN 1.17549435e-38
          #define DBL_MIN 2.225073858507201e-308
          /* minimum negative integer such that 10 raised to that power is in the range of
          normalized floating-point numbers */
          #define FLT_MIN_10_EXP      -37
          #define DBL_MIN_10_EXP      -307
          /* maximum integer such that FLT_RADIX raised to that power minus 1 is a
          representable finite floating-point number */
          #define FLT_MAX_EXP         +128
          #define DBL_MAX_EXP         +1024
          /* maximum representable finite floating-point number */
          #define FLT_MAX 3.40282347e+38
          #define DBL_MAX 1.797693134862316e+308
          /* maximum integer such that 10 raised to that power is in the range of representable
          finite floating-point numbers */
          #define FLT_MAX_10_EXP      +38
          #define DBL_MAX_10_EXP      +308

     The file < sys/limits.h> contains:

          #define ARG_MAX 5120   /* max length of arguments to exec */
          #define CHILD_MAX      25        /* max # of processes per user id */
          #define CLK_TCK 100    /* # of clock ticks per second */
          #define FCHR_MAX       1048576   /* max size of a file in bytes */
          #define LINK_MAX       32767     /* max # of links to a single file */
          #define NAME_MAX       14        /* max # of characters in a file name */
          #define OPEN_MAX       20        /* max # of files a process can have open */
          #define PASS_MAX       8         /* max # of characters in a password */
          #define PATH_MAX       256       /* max # of characters in a path name */
          #define PID_MAX 30000  /* max value for a process ID */
          #define PIPE_BUF       5120      /* max # bytes atomic in write to a pipe */
          #define PIPE_MAX       5120      /* max # bytes written to a pipe in a write */
          #define SHRT_MAX       32767     /* max decimal value of a ``short'' */
          #define SHRT_MIN       -32767    /* min decimal value of a ``short'' */
          #define STD_BLK 1024   /* # bytes in a physical I/O block */
          #define SYS_NMLN       9         /* # of chars in uname-returned strings */
          #define UID_MAX 30000  /* max value for a user or group ID */
